Container orchestration is the big fight of the moment.
What is container orchestration.
Kubernetes is an open source container management orchestration tool.
Container orchestration automates the deployment management scaling and networking of containers.
Container orchestration is all about managing the lifecycles of containers especially in large dynamic environments.
The widely deployed container orchestration platforms are based on open source versions like kubernetes docker swarm or the commercial version from red hat.
Each microservice is packaged as a container.
Container orchestration is the automatic process of managing or scheduling the work of individual containers for applications based on microservices within multiple clusters.
It s container management responsibilities include container deployment scaling descaling of containers container load balancing.
But when it comes to services.
Container orchestration can be used in any environment where you use containers.
Application modernization devops.
Containerization has changed the way software is built deployed and maintained.
Back to technical glossary.
Kubernetes is not a containerization platform.
Enterprises that need to deploy and manage hundreds or thousands of linux containers and hosts can benefit from container orchestration.
Container orchestration encourages the use of the microservices architecture pattern in which an application is composed of smaller atomic independent services each one designed for a single task.
Container orchestration should be seen as a way to handle and manage a large number of containers.
Provisioning and deployment of containers.
It is a multi container management solution.